The Digital Repository of Ireland (DRI) in collaboration with the Public Record Office of Northern Ireland (PRONI) are hosting a live webinar on 7 Sept that might be of interest to the DLF community. Further details about the event are below.





Engaging Communities with Archives: Video as a tool for activism, advocacy, and archival work



7 Sept 2021, 19:00 IST (14:00 EDT/20:00 CEST)



How can video be used as a tool to democratise and open up archives or bring about social and cultural transformations? Join the Digital Repository of Ireland (DRI) and the Public Record Office of Northern Ireland (PRONI) on 7 Sept for a collaborative webinar exploring archival initiatives that seek to engage communities with archives. The webinar focuses on projects that aim to train or support community groups in using video to tell personal stories, bring about social change, or preserve activism and advocacy work. The event will be chaired by Dr Laura Aguiar, Community Engagement Officer & Creative Producer at PRONI.


Speakers include:



·         Lynsey Gillespie, archivist at PRONI and curator for the Making the Future project, a cross-border cultural programme that aims to empower people to use museum collections and archives to explore the past and create a powerful vision for future change.

·         Yvonne Ng, audiovisual archivist and archives program manager at WITNESS, where she trains and supports partners on collecting, managing, and preserving video documentation for human rights evidence and advocacy.

·         Elizabeth (Liz) Miller, a documentary maker and professor interested in new approaches to community collaborations and to documentary making as a way to connect personal stories to larger social concerns.
